Frequently asked questions about Cheltenham Music Society

What does Cheltenham Music Society do?

Promotion of classical music concerts in Cheltenham for the general public

How much income did Cheltenham Music Society report in 2025?

Cheltenham Music Society reported total income of £80k and reported expenditure of £46k for the financial year ending 2025, based on the most recent annual return filed with the Charity Commission.

When was Cheltenham Music Society registered as a charity?

Cheltenham Music Society was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 6 February 1980 as charity number 279209. It has been registered for 46 years.

Who runs Cheltenham Music Society?

Cheltenham Music Society is governed by a board of 9 trustees. The chair of trustees is DAVID EDWIN PEPPER. Trustees are legally responsible for the charity's governance and are listed in full on its profile.

Where does Cheltenham Music Society operate?

Cheltenham Music Society operates in Gloucestershire, as recorded in its Charity Commission filing.

Is Cheltenham Music Society a registered charity?

Yes — Cheltenham Music Society is a registered charity in England and Wales, charity number 279209.
